I was away for 2 days and tried out a new light and now the ladies have become like this lol my question is should I throw them away now or send them into bloom :)
It's a very particular question, it depends of your grow space. What I would do, remove the first node with the first real leaves, supercrop it at the height of the second node, leaving it horizontal, grow two more weeks and flip to flowering.
I had similar happen. Well in bad light adjustment causing too long nodes. I topped let recover then bent the stem over and then continued adjusting branches. I’m happy with the progress considering. I wouldn’t trash it
Could just do an aggressive topping and let it re veg out. or just bend it down with some HST.
I don't think you need to restart just support it going into bloom from a streched main stalk or top it and let it regrow under normal lighting.
